Originally Posted by polobai
Hated the fingerprints on my pcm-so I purchased a tempered glass screen protector for it from Amazon for around $10. It made the Matt screen high gloss and reduces fingerprints-but does not eliminate completely. Will roll with it to see how the gloss impacts it out in the sun but it does seem to match my gloss black trim better


To follow up, I took the car out yesterday and am really happy with this piece. It makes the screen more vibrant and gives additional depth-also the edges are tapered and fingerprints are greatly reduced. No issues with glare but I have an slicktop car. I would imagine for cars with open roofs or sunroofs this could be an issue.
